Company Overview

Founded in 2000, Walker-Miller Energy Services is a core-values driven company committed to changing lives through energy efficiency. We create and manage customized energy waste reduction programs that help electric and gas utilities meet mandated energy savings goals.

Our experience driven philosophy of energy efficiency as economic development helps families and businesses save energy and save money. Through innovative, inclusive initiatives, we help build communities by creating local jobs, producing equitable energy savings for all rate payers, and spurring the growth of diverse local businesses.

Position Summary:

We are seeking a skilled and experienced Associate Program Manager to help lead a large-scale, high-profile residential energy efficiency program in Illinois. The ideal candidate will have at least 3-5 years of experience in program management, a deep understanding of energy efficiency for residential and multi-family sectors, and some experience and exposure to electrification. This role requires strong leadership and client management skills, and the ability to work with diverse stakeholders effectively.

Essential Responsibilities:

  • Embrace and operate within the core values.
  • Assist in leading and managing large-scale residential energy efficiency programs from inception to completion.
  • Oversee the day-to-day operations of the program and staff, ensuring timely and successful delivery of services.
  • Interface with clients, stakeholders, and partners at various levels to ensure program success and address any concerns or issues.
  • Monitor program performance, conduct regular assessments, and identify and assist in the implementation of improvements to enhance program effectiveness and efficiency.
  • Coordinate with internal teams, including engineering, finance, and marketing, to ensure cohesive program execution.
  • Prepare and present detailed reports on program progress, outcomes, and impact to clients and senior management.
  • Stay up to date with industry trends, best practices, and regulatory changes related to energy efficiency and electrification.
  • Monitor program budgets, track expenses, and assist in meeting financial goals.

Minimum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in Engineering, Environmental Science, Business, or a related field, or equivalent work experience.
  • Minimum of 3-5 years of experience in the energy efficiency sector.
  • Previous supervisory experience.
  • Strong understanding of energy efficiency principles, practices, and technologies for residential and multi-family buildings.
  • Excellent client interfacing skills with the ability to build and maintain strong relationships.
  • Strong leadership and team management skills.
  • Exceptional communication and presentation abilities.
  • Analytical and problem-solving skills with a focus on continuous improvement.
  • Proficiency in project management software and tools.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office, specifically Excel, Outlook, and PowerPoint.

Desired Qualifications:

  • Advanced degree, preferred.
  • 5-8 years of experience in program management of energy efficiency programs.
  • Advanced skills in Microsoft Excel and PowerPoint

Licenses & Certification:

  • CAPM or PMP Certification, preferred.
  • BPI Building Science Principles Certification, preferred.

Travel Requirements:

  • Willing to travel up to 20%.

Physical Demands and Work Environment:

  • Required to sit, stand, walk; talk and hear; and ability to touch and handle tools and/or controls.
  • Ability to lift up to 30 pounds.
  • Noise level is typically low to moderate.

Pay Transparency: This compensation range is provided as a reasonable estimate of the current starting salary range for this role. If this opportunity includes multiple job levels, the salary information represents the job level minimum and the job level maximum. There are multiple factors that are considered in determining final pay for a position, including, but not limited to, relevant work experience, skills, certifications and competencies that align to the specified role, geographic location, education and certifications as well as contract provisions regarding labor categories that are specific to the position.

A team member may be eligible for additional pay, premiums, or bonus potential. Walker-Miller Energy Services offers eligible employees health, vision and dental insurance, retirement, and tuition reimbursement.

Compensation Range: $66,000-$85,000/ annually
